MrWookie47 08-17-2005 12:41 PM

Re: Newb preflop play, please help.
 
At first I was going to say that checking was good, but seeing that this is 5 handed (less likely that the UTG limper has a better A), raising is not too bad a plan. You probably have an edge, but it's not too huge. Waiting to the flop to exploit a bigger edge is a reasonable plan, if perhaps not totally optimal 5 handed. You have to weigh your opponents, and how well you play postflop.

Your postflop play is perfect.

MrWookie47 08-17-2005 12:43 PM

Re: Newb preflop play, please help.
 
[ QUOTE ]
Oh, by the way I lost to Q 9 offsuit. If that helps any.

[/ QUOTE ]

Don't be results oriented. Actually, had you raised preflop, SB's play would have been close to perfect, but your lack of a raise forced him to make a big mistake (according to the FToP) on the flop by calling your bet. You won a lot of Sklansky bucks on this hand.

MrWookie47 08-17-2005 12:54 PM

Re: Newb preflop play, please help.
 
The Fundamental Theorem of Poker. Sklansky's Theory of Poker is a great (mandatory) read.

Edit: When you asked if there was anything you could do protect, you did. You offered a 5 out draw 4:1 odds, and he took them. That's a really big mistake on his part, and you'll gain large sums of money in the long run based on his play. The long run, however, is very, very long.
